Murray Hill is highly walkable. Many services and amenities are within walking distance, allowing most errands to be handled without a car. The area has several public transportation options, offering convenience for some routes and destinations. Murray Hill is a biker’s paradise, with an extensive and well-maintained cycling infrastructure for seamless biking.

Average utility cost in New York
In New York, renters typically spend around $470 per month on utilities, with costs ranging from $30 for internet to $148 for electricity , depending on factors like home size, season, and usage.
